Figure Lengend Snippet: On the left, schematic representation of the mesocosms heated with a gradient of temperatures (from +1 to + 8 °C above ambient). Zooplankton samples were collected with a plankton net in Spring and Autumn 2019 and analysed with a FlowCam (High- throughput flow cytometry coupled with machine learning), if smaller than 1 mm, and with a microscope if bigger than 1 mm, to obtain body measurements and abundance data.
Article Snippet: The first two zooplankton size classes (75–250 μm, 250–1000 μm) were analysed using a Bench Top FlowCAM ® 8000 (Fluid Imaging Technologies, Inc. Maine, USA) with particle analysis software (VisualSpreadsheet © , version 4).
